You may hear of the appendix as a rudimentary structure in humans, and in smaller animals the appendix may be known as the caecum. Basically, the appendix is a small piece of tissue that forms a tiny pouch in the large intestine, near the junction of the end of the small intestine and the beginning of the large intestine. It has no real known function in humans and is thought to have had a function in more primitive stages of our evolution. The appendix is also susceptible to blockage, and due to continued secretion by the glands located in the walls of the appendix, this may result in appendicitis, which has the potential to be fatal if left untreated.
